What is VLAN in networking?
In the world of networking, a VLAN (Virtual Local Area Network) is a method of creating separate networks within a larger physical network. The concept of VLANs was introduced to overcome the limitations of traditional physical networks, which involve connecting devices to a single broadcast domain. VLANs allow you to logically divide a physical network into multiple isolated networks, without the need for separate physical infrastructure. This article will provide a detailed overview of VLANs, covering everything from their basics and benefits, to their various types, setup, configuration, and troubleshooting.
The Basics of VLAN: Definition and Function
A VLAN is essentially a group of devices that communicate with each other as if they were on their own isolated network, irrespective of their physical location. This is achieved by assigning a VLAN ID to each device (e.g., switch, router, server, and workstation), which enables devices to belong to a specific VLAN. Devices within the same VLAN can communicate with each other directly and quickly, without traversing the entire physical network. VLANs are useful for separating traffic, controlling broadcast domains, and improving network performance and security.
One of the key benefits of VLANs is that they allow network administrators to segment their network into smaller, more manageable parts. This can be particularly useful in large organizations where different departments or teams may have different network requirements. By creating separate VLANs for each group, administrators can ensure that each team has access to the resources they need, while also maintaining network security and performance.
Another advantage of VLANs is that they can help to reduce network congestion and improve overall network performance. By separating traffic into different VLANs, administrators can ensure that each VLAN has its own dedicated bandwidth, which can help to prevent bottlenecks and ensure that critical applications and services have the resources they need to function properly.
How VLANs Improve Network Security
One of the main benefits of VLANs is enhanced network security. VLANs enable a network administrator to isolate sensitive data or devices to specific VLANs, allowing access only to authorized members of that VLAN. Unauthorized access to sensitive data or resources within a VLAN can be prevented by implementing access control lists (ACLs), which restrict network traffic based on the source or destination IP addresses, protocols, or ports. VLANs also help prevent common attacks like ARP spoofing, IP spoofing, and denial-of-service (DoS) attacks, by isolating the attack to a specific VLAN.
Another way VLANs improve network security is by reducing the risk of network congestion and improving network performance. By segmenting the network into smaller, more manageable VLANs, network traffic can be controlled and prioritized. This ensures that critical applications and services receive the necessary bandwidth and resources, while less important traffic is limited. Additionally, VLANs can be used to separate different types of traffic, such as voice and data, to prevent interference and improve overall network performance.
VLAN vs Subnet: What’s the Difference?
VLANs are often confused with subnets, which are another method of segregating network traffic. The main difference between the two is that VLANs operate at Layer 2 of the OSI model, while subnets are configured at Layer 3. VLANs are used to segment a physical network into multiple virtual broadcast domains, whereas subnets are used to segment a network into smaller, logical networks based on IP addresses.
Another key difference between VLANs and subnets is that VLANs are typically used to group devices based on their function or location, while subnets are used to group devices based on their IP addresses. For example, a company might create a VLAN for all of its finance department devices, regardless of their physical location, to ensure that sensitive financial data is kept separate from other network traffic. On the other hand, a company might create a subnet for all devices on a particular floor of a building, to improve network performance by reducing the amount of broadcast traffic that needs to be sent across the network.
How to Configure and Set up a VLAN Network
Configuring and setting up a VLAN network involves several steps, including creating VLANs, assigning VLAN IDs, configuring access ports, and configuring trunk ports. The first step is to create VLANs based on your network requirements. The next step is to assign VLAN IDs to each VLAN, which is a unique number between 1 and 4094. Access ports are then configured to belong to a specific VLAN, while trunk ports are configured to carry traffic from multiple VLANs. Once the VLANs are set up, their traffic can be managed using various network protocols such as STP, VTP, and VLAN tagging.
It is important to note that VLANs provide several benefits to a network, including increased security, improved network performance, and simplified network management. By separating network traffic into different VLANs, it is easier to control access to sensitive data and prevent unauthorized access. Additionally, VLANs can help reduce network congestion by limiting the amount of traffic on each VLAN. Finally, managing a network with VLANs is simpler and more efficient, as network administrators can easily make changes to specific VLANs without affecting the entire network.
Types of VLANs: Port-based, Tag-based, and Protocol-based
There are three main types of VLANs: port-based VLANs, tag-based VLANs, and protocol-based VLANs. Port-based VLANs are created by associating switch ports with specific VLAN IDs, and are the most commonly used type. Tag-based VLANs are created by tagging each packet with a VLAN ID, and can be used to carry traffic from multiple VLANs over a single trunk port. Protocol-based VLANs are created based on the protocol used by the traffic, and are typically used to separate voice and data traffic.
Advantages and Disadvantages of Using a VLAN Network
There are numerous advantages of using a VLAN network, including improved network security, better performance, greater scalability, simplified network management, and reduced hardware costs. VLANs can also reduce network congestion by limiting broadcast traffic and VLAN hopping. However, implementing a VLAN network can also have some disadvantages, including the need for more advanced network equipment, increased complexity, and potential misconfiguration issues.
Common Mistakes to Avoid when Setting up a VLAN Network
Setting up a VLAN network can be challenging, especially if you are not familiar with VLAN concepts and terminology. Some common mistakes to avoid when setting up a VLAN network include improper VLAN tagging, misconfigured VLAN trunk links, overlapping IP address ranges, and lack of VLAN security and access control.
Troubleshooting Tips for Common VLAN Network Issues
Like any network technology, VLANs can experience issues such as network loops, VLAN mismatch, and VLAN configuration errors. Troubleshooting VLAN issues involves checking VLAN configurations, analyzing network traffic, verifying switch port configurations, and checking trunk port configurations. Network monitoring tools like Wireshark can also be helpful in identifying VLAN issues.
VLAN Best Practices for Enhancing Network Performance and Scalability
Implementing VLAN best practices can help optimize network performance and scalability. This includes segmenting network traffic based on application types, minimizing VLAN hopping, implementing proper access control and security policies, monitoring VLAN traffic, and using VLAN tagging to carry traffic more efficiently over trunk links.
Importance of Understanding VLANs in Modern Networking Environments
VLANs play a critical role in modern networking environments by enabling network architects to design more efficient, secure, and manageable networks. Understanding VLANs is essential for network administrators and engineers who want to build scalable, flexible, and resilient networks that can meet the demands of today’s digital world.
Top Tools and Software for Managing VLAN Networks
There are numerous tools and software available for managing VLAN networks, including network monitoring tools like SolarWinds, Cisco Network Assistant, and HP Intelligent Management Center (IMC). These tools help network administrators manage VLAN configurations, monitor VLAN traffic, detect VLAN mismatches, and troubleshoot VLAN issues.
Future Trends in the Development of VLAN Technologies
The development of VLAN technologies is constantly evolving, with new trends emerging each year. Some of the future trends in VLAN technologies include the adoption of Software-Defined Networking (SDN), the integration of VLANs with virtualization technologies like VMware and Hyper-V, and the use of advanced security mechanisms like MACsec and 802.1x authentication to enhance VLAN security.
The Impact of Virtualization on VLAN Networks
The rapid adoption of virtualization technologies like VMware and Hyper-V has had a significant impact on VLAN networks. Virtualization enables network administrators to create and manage virtual VLAN networks within a single physical network, using virtual switches and routers. This approach allows for greater flexibility, agility, and scalability, while reducing hardware costs and simplifying network management.
Real-World Examples of Successful Implementations of VLAN Networks
There are numerous real-world examples of successful implementations of VLAN networks, including educational institutions, healthcare organizations, government agencies, and large enterprises. One such example is the University of Southern California (USC), which used VLANs to segment network traffic based on application types, resulting in improved network performance and reduced network congestion.
Conclusion
In conclusion, VLANs are an essential networking technology that enable network administrators to create secure, high-performance, and scalable networks. Understanding VLANs is crucial for anyone involved in network design, implementation, and management, as they play a critical role in modern networking environments. With the right tools, best practices, and knowledge, VLAN networks can be set up and managed effectively, providing organizations with a robust and reliable network infrastructure that can meet the demands of today’s digital world.